Arrived for the supercharging and decided to cool off inside with a fun lunch.
The atmosphere is some of the best in Austin, wide open spaces with high vaulted ceilings. It's so nice not to feel claustrophobic or old and moldy and archaic like other restaurants in ATX. The bathroom fixtures are sophisticated and better than almost any ATX bathroom. There is plenty of room to maneuver with a large group. It reminds me of my time abroad and I wish more Austin places were like this. I just really enjoy the ambiance here, it's a third home really. Kind of what you wish Starbucks (used to be) and even Mozart's could be.
The Food: I had the chopped salad and a giant pretzel. The pretzel itself was perfectly done, not too crisp, no burn marks. I liked the mustard dipping sauces a lot. Be forewarned, they are intense and you should like Dijon mustard a lot. I used them sparingly, it was fun to try something new you can't get just anywhere. The chopped salad was the best, perfectly sized for a medium lunch, but not overly small. The Dijon vinaigrette was perfection. I've also had the hippie vegan burger with the basil slaw which is even better than the pretzel and chopped salad, highly recommend anything here, I don't think you can really go wrong.
The service is ridiculously good, they are prompt and it's kind of like Loro and super easy to walk up and order. They always ask how I'm doing too.
I wish they offered a brunch everyday, I'd certainly come to try the fried green tomatoes Benedict on a Tuesday morning. I'm excited to return and try a dessert and pizza and wish they'd add Pinthouse's honey pear to the menu here and maybe some chips and queso type options. I don't drink alcohol and this was such a nice surprise for me to find a cute lunch spot, even if the focus is beer first and foremost.
